Periodically, the police set up DUI checkpoints but there are rules and regulations that they must follow. In addition a notice must be published in a local newspaper the day before. The rules require the police to follow certain guidelines. For example the police can’t pick and choose who they want to stop. It has to be done in a certain way, like every fifth car in order to be fair and random. Most importantly for you, there has to be an area where before you drive into the chute, where they direct all the cars, for you to make a last minute u-turn if you wish to avoid being stopped.
